qmail is a Unix mail transfer agent for sending, receiving, and relaying SMTP email. It emphasizes security through process separation and a modular architecture, but its original codebase and ecosystem are dated.

πŸ’‘ Choose it if you want a modern all-in-one self-hosted mail server rather than qmail's SMTP-focused core.

Maddy is an open-source all-in-one mail server written in Go for self-hosters and small organizations. It combines SMTP submission and delivery with...

Pros

  • Provides more of a complete mail stack than Haraka
  • Includes IMAP, authentication, and DKIM in one project
  • Simpler deployment than assembling separate SMTP components

Cons

  • Less mature ecosystem than Postfix-based deployments
  • Less programmable than Haraka's plugin architecture
  • Smaller community and fewer hosting integrations
